Let’s start by understanding why chin fat can be so persistent. Unlike fat in other areas, submental fat (the technical term for that under-chin area) contains a high density of fat cells that are resistant to typical weight loss methods. This is because the body prioritizes burning fat from other regions first, like the abdomen or thighs, making the chin area a last-resort energy source. Add factors like loss of skin elasticity with age or a genetic predisposition to store fat there, and you’ve got a perfect recipe for stubborn pockets.
Enter non-surgical fat-dissolving treatments. These minimally invasive options have gained popularity over the last decade, offering a middle ground between lifestyle changes and surgical liposuction. The most well-known method uses injectable solutions containing deoxycholic acid, a naturally occurring molecule that breaks down dietary fat. When injected into the chin area, it disrupts fat cell membranes, allowing the body to gradually metabolize and eliminate them over several weeks. Clinical studies show an average 20-25% reduction in fat volume after just 2-4 sessions, with results appearing smoother than abrupt surgical changes.
But how does this compare to alternatives like CoolSculpting or traditional lipo? While cryolipolysis (freezing fat cells) works well for larger areas, the precision of injectables makes them ideal for small, delicate zones like the chin. As board-certified dermatologist Dr. Emily Sanders explains, “The under-chin area requires millimeter-level accuracy to avoid affecting nearby muscles or nerves—something injectables deliver better than freezing devices.” Surgical options, though effective, come with higher costs, anesthesia risks, and weeks of recovery. For busy individuals wanting subtle improvements without downtime, dissolving treatments hit a sweet spot.
Side effects are usually mild but worth noting. Temporary swelling, numbness, or bruising at the injection site typically fades within 3-5 days. Rarely, patients report slight unevenness or nerve irritation, which often resolves as the body continues processing the treated fat over 6-8 weeks. Experts recommend avoiding blood-thinning medications before treatment and sleeping slightly elevated afterward to minimize swelling.
Who’s the ideal candidate? If you pinch the area under your chin and feel a soft, doughy layer (not just skin), you likely have enough fat to benefit. These treatments aren’t weight-loss tools—they’re designed for people at or near their goal weight who want contouring. During consultations, practitioners often use a “snap test,” gently flicking the chin to see how much skin snaps back. Good skin elasticity ensures smoother results as fat diminishes.
Aftercare is straightforward: stay hydrated, avoid excessive salt to reduce swelling, and consider gentle lymphatic massage to speed up fat metabolism. Some clinics combine treatments with skin-tightening radiofrequency for enhanced results. Maintenance sessions might be needed every 1-2 years, depending on aging and lifestyle factors.
Cost-wise, expect to invest between $1,200-$2,500 for a full treatment series—far less than surgery but pricier than topical creams (which, let’s be real, rarely work for deep fat). Many practices offer payment plans, and since downtime is minimal, you won’t lose income from taking days off work.
